6 Leeds Old Road, Bradford, BD3 8HT is a freehold semi-detached property built between 1950-1966. The property offers approximately 1,033 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£86,086 , which equates to approximately £83 per square foot. It was last sold on 29 Jun 2010 for £53,000. Since then, the value has increased by £33,086, representing a 62.4% increase, or approximately 4.0% per year.

The current estimated value of £86,086 is:

  • 77.0% lower than the average property price on Leeds Old Road
  • 40.9% lower than the average in the BD3 8HT postcode area
  • and 53.2% lower than the average price for Bradford as a whole

At the most recent EPC inspection on 20 February 2022, the property was recorded as rented.

6 Leeds Old Road, Bradford, West Yorkshire, BD3 8HT has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 20 Feb 2022.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 17 Aug 2010, when the property was rated C. The current rating of D reflects a decline in energy efficiency of 12.5%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 250 mm loft insulation to pitched, 200 mm loft insulation, with no change in energy efficiency (good).
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from cavity wall, filled cavity to sandstone or limestone, as built, no insulation (assumed), changing energy efficiency from good to very poor.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 20%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from poor to very good.
